Van Westen Vineyards Vino Grigio 2008
Naramata Bench, Okanagan Valley, British Columbia, CanadaSimilar to the 07 with bright floral lifted mineral, green apple skin and spicy honey/melon aromas. The entry is crisp and dry with an oily/gewürztraminer-like character. The palate is clean with more grassy, grapefruit, green apple, honey flavours and a touch of citrus rind in the finish. Solid and should be fine with mussels, or Thai dishes.Tasted: 30 December 2009Tasted by: Anthony Gismondi and Stuart TobePrices:BC | $19.00 | 750ml | winery direct and private wine shops |
